How Gasoline Interacts With Plastic Bags

can gasoline dissolve plastic bags

Gasoline is a highly flammable liquid that should never be stored in plastic bags. This is because gasoline is a solvent and a hydrocarbon, and ordinary plastics also contain hydrocarbons that gasoline will dissolve. Some plastics are more resistant to gasoline than others, but it is still not advisable to use plastic containers to store gasoline. There have been instances of people filling plastic bags with gasoline during fuel shortages, but this is extremely dangerous and can have deadly consequences. It is always best to use approved containers designed to handle flammable liquids when storing or transporting gasoline.

Ordinary plastic contains hydrocarbons

It is important to note that not all plastics are alike. Some plastics can be dissolved by gasoline, while others are not affected. Gasoline is a solvent and a hydrocarbon, and ordinary plastics are also made of hydrocarbons, which is why gasoline can dissolve some types of plastic. This concept is known as "like dissolves like".

The hydrocarbons used to create ordinary plastic are derived from fossil fuels such as crude oil, natural gas, and coal. Crude oil, for example, is decomposed into fractions through distillation, separating lighter gases like gasoline from heavier liquids and solids. The long-chain hydrocarbons obtained through this process are then converted into the hydrocarbons used to make plastic. This indicates that the hydrocarbons in ordinary plastic are closely related to the hydrocarbons in gasoline, which is why gasoline can dissolve certain types of plastic.

It is worth noting that the ability of gasoline to dissolve plastic depends on the specific type of plastic. Some plastics may not be directly dissolved but can weaken over time when exposed to gasoline. Therefore, it is crucial to use approved containers designed to handle flammable liquids when storing or transporting gasoline.

In summary, ordinary plastic contains hydrocarbons, which are also present in gasoline. The relationship between the two substances, as described by the concept of "like dissolves like," explains why gasoline can dissolve certain types of plastic. However, it is important to be cautious and use appropriate containers to ensure safety when dealing with flammable liquids like gasoline.

Gasoline melts plastic

It is important to note that gasoline should not be stored in plastic bags. Gasoline is a solvent and a hydrocarbon, and ordinary plastics also contain hydrocarbons which gasoline will dissolve. This is because "like dissolves like". Gasoline has been observed to break down and dissolve some plastics, but not all. For instance, some plastic gas cans are designed to handle gasoline, but plastic bags are not.

The U.S. Consumer Product Safety Commission has warned against storing gasoline in plastic bags, as it is dangerous. Gasoline gives off flammable fumes, and a plastic bag is a flimsy vessel that can easily leak or spill, causing a fire hazard. There have been instances of people filling plastic bags with gasoline during fuel shortages, but this is not safe. If you must hoard gasoline, use proper gas cans that are approved for fuel storage. These cans have safety features like a flash-arresting screen, a spring-closing lid, and a spout cover to relieve internal pressure during fire exposure.

The chemical similarity between gasoline and plastic means that some forms of plastic can be considered "frozen gasoline". This means that gasoline can dissolve certain types of plastic, turning it back into a liquid state. However, not all plastics are alike, and some are more resistant to gasoline. For example, Polypropylene plastic is not dissolved by gasoline.

Additionally, while it is possible to dissolve plastic bags in gasoline to create a workable fuel, this is not an efficient process due to the low energy density of plastic. The resulting solution may also be more toxic or prone to explosion, making it a less viable option as a fuel source.

In summary, while gasoline can melt or dissolve some types of plastic, it is essential to use approved containers for fuel storage to prevent accidents and potential hazards.

Gasoline vaporizes faster in hot temperatures

Gasoline is a highly volatile substance that can be dangerous if not handled and stored properly. One critical aspect of its storage is maintaining a cool temperature because gasoline vaporizes faster in hot temperatures. This phenomenon is due to the kinetic energy of the molecules within the gasoline.

Kinetic energy plays a crucial role in the evaporation process. Evaporation occurs when molecules near the surface of a liquid possess sufficient kinetic energy to break free and transition into the gas phase. As temperatures increase, the kinetic energy of the molecules also increases, leading to a higher evaporation rate. Conversely, at lower temperatures, the kinetic energy of the molecules decreases, resulting in a slower evaporation process.

In the context of gasoline, this principle holds true. Gasoline vaporizes more rapidly in hot temperatures due to the heightened kinetic energy of its molecules. This increased kinetic energy enables a larger number of molecules to escape, transforming from a liquid state to a gaseous form. Consequently, gasoline expands when it gets warmer, and its vapors can ignite, posing a significant safety hazard.

To mitigate the risks associated with gasoline vaporization, it is essential to control the temperature at which it is stored. For instance, when filling up a vehicle's gas tank, it is advisable to do so during the early morning when ground temperatures are lower. This helps to maintain the density of the gasoline and minimizes the creation of vapors during the pumping process.
